apologize to say that you are sorry.
birthday the day on which a person was born, usually celebrated each year on that date.
bunch a group of things of the same kind that are attached to each other.
carve to form or write by cutting.
envelope a folded paper covering for a letter or other papers you mail. You write the address and put a stamp on an envelope before you mail it.
fruit the part of a plant that has seeds and flesh. Most fruits that people eat are sweet.
hamburger ground meat, or a round flat mass of ground meat that is cooked and served on bread.
horrible causing a feeling of fear or horror.
merry cheerful and happy.
odor a smell, often a bad one.
recycle to put used things through a process that allows them to be used again.
snap to break suddenly with a cracking noise.
solar having to do with or coming from the sun.
tail a part of an animal's body that sticks out from the back end.
tear1 a drop of liquid that comes from the eye. Tears clean the eye and keep it wet.
